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/326.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/spring/13.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 无法在返回类型为streamingResponseBody的postHandle方法中拦截rest请求_Java_Spring_Spring Boot_Rest_Spring Mvc - Fatal编程技术网

Java 无法在返回类型为streamingResponseBody的postHandle方法中拦截rest请求

Java 无法在返回类型为streamingResponseBody的postHandle方法中拦截rest请求,java,spring,spring-boot,rest,spring-mvc,Java,Spring,Spring Boot,Rest,Spring Mvc,我将rest api返回类型从string更改为StreamingResponseBody。但现有的请求拦截器(即HandlerInterceptorAdapter postHandle方法)未能拦截。我需要管理拦截器中的请求服务计数,以便在任何给定时间,我的RESTAPI都不会服务超过x个请求。有人能指导我如何修复我的拦截器吗?或者我需要进行其他调整吗?HandlerInterceptorAdaptor不能处理异步请求

我将rest api返回类型从string更改为StreamingResponseBody。但现有的请求拦截器(即HandlerInterceptorAdapter postHandle方法)未能拦截。我需要管理拦截器中的请求服务计数,以便在任何给定时间,我的RESTAPI都不会服务超过x个请求。有人能指导我如何修复我的拦截器吗?或者我需要进行其他调整吗?HandlerInterceptorAdaptor不能处理异步请求